Question 984311: In a circular track of 63 meters two runners run with speeds 9m/s and 7 m/s. At how many distinct meeting points will they meet?
i figured they meet every 31.5 second and i worked out that the number of distinct meeting points is 2. however, what i do not understand is this solution that you can take the ratio of the speeds in simplest form, subtract, and then get the number of distinct meeting points.
What I mean is 9-7 =2 which is your answer
Can you please derive this method.

Also if they were traveling in opposite directions the method says to add 9 and 7 which gives you 16 distinct meeting points. I don't understand this either.
